Transaction e8a3bbdd2bc2cc917d7956f7c2568845d3b99f2b9799783c48e3307faaefeaa0
1 Input
1 Output
-
e8a3bbdd2bc2cc917d7956f7c2568845d3b99f2b9799783c48e3307faaefeaa0:0
- value
- 644055347
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d58be4b70eccedeedce62db848bd2b4a7466af31 OP_EQUALVERIFY OP_CHECKSIG
- address
- Leh5n3A4ooK8H1uGznvjULnJ5bNXmSERqV